还在为语雀文档迁移而烦恼吗?面对平台政策变化,如何快速安全地将你的宝贵文档备份到本地?本文将为你详细介绍语雀文档导出工具的使用方法,让你轻松实现知识库的本地化备份。

【免费下载链接】yuque-exporter 【免费下载链接】yuque-exporter 项目地址: https://gitcode.com/gh_mirrors/yuqu/yuque-exporter

为什么需要语雀文档导出工具

随着语雀平台商业化进程的推进,许多用户发现原有的免费功能开始受限。特别是对于个人博客作者和技术文档撰写者来说,文档的长期存储和可移植性变得尤为重要。语雀文档导出工具应运而生,它能够:

  • 批量导出语雀知识库中的所有文档
  • 保持原有的目录结构和层级关系
  • 将文档转换为标准Markdown格式
  • 保留图片、表格等富文本内容

快速上手:5分钟完成配置

环境准备

首先确保你的系统已安装Node.js环境。打开终端输入以下命令检查:

node --version
npm --version

如果显示版本号,说明环境已就绪。若未安装,请前往Node.js官网下载安装包。

获取项目代码

通过以下命令获取语雀导出工具:

git clone https://gitcode.com/gh_mirrors/yuqu/yuque-exporter

进入项目目录:

cd yuque-exporter

安装项目依赖:

npm install

获取语雀API令牌

  1. 登录语雀官网
  2. 进入个人设置页面
  3. 找到"令牌管理"选项
  4. 创建新的API令牌并妥善保存

核心功能详解

批量导出功能

该工具支持一次性导出整个知识库,包括:

  • 所有文档内容
  • 目录层级结构
  • 附件和图片资源
  • 文档元数据信息

格式转换能力

导出后的文档采用标准Markdown格式,兼容性强:

  • 支持各大Markdown编辑器
  • 可直接发布到GitHub Pages
  • 便于迁移到其他文档平台

实战操作步骤

第一步:配置环境变量

在项目根目录下,设置语雀API令牌:

export YUQUE_TOKEN=你的API令牌

第二步:运行导出程序

执行以下命令开始导出:

npm start

程序将自动连接语雀API,获取你的知识库列表,并开始批量下载文档。

第三步:查看导出结果

导出完成后,你将在项目目录下的output文件夹中找到所有文档:

  • 按知识库名称分类
  • 保持原有目录结构
  • 图片等资源自动下载

常见问题解决方案

问题一:API令牌无效

确保令牌已正确生成并具有读取权限。重新生成令牌后重试。

问题二:网络连接超时

检查网络连接,或尝试使用网络加速工具。

问题三:导出内容不完整

确认令牌权限是否足够,部分私有文档可能需要额外授权。

高级使用技巧

选择性导出

如果你只需要导出特定知识库,可以修改配置文件中的参数,实现精准导出。

定时备份

结合系统定时任务,你可以设置定期自动备份,确保文档安全。

应用场景举例

个人博客迁移

将语雀中的技术博客文章导出,重新部署到静态网站生成器如Hexo、Hugo等。

团队文档备份

为团队重要文档创建本地备份,防止因平台变更导致的数据丢失。

内容多平台发布

一份内容,多处发布。将语雀文档导出后,可以轻松发布到多个平台。

总结

语雀文档导出工具为你的知识资产管理提供了可靠保障。通过简单的几步操作,你就能将辛苦创作的文档安全地备份到本地。无论是应对平台政策变化,还是实现内容的多平台分发,这个工具都能为你节省大量时间和精力。

记住,数据安全从备份开始。现在就动手试试吧!

【免费下载链接】yuque-exporter 【免费下载链接】yuque-exporter 项目地址: https://gitcode.com/gh_mirrors/yuqu/yuque-exporter

Logo

火山引擎开发者社区是火山引擎打造的AI技术生态平台,聚焦Agent与大模型开发,提供豆包系列模型(图像/视频/视觉)、智能分析与会话工具,并配套评测集、动手实验室及行业案例库。社区通过技术沙龙、挑战赛等活动促进开发者成长,新用户可领50万Tokens权益,助力构建智能应用。

更多推荐